which of the following is a sign of anaphylaxis?
upset stomach
hallucinations
wheezing
bleeding gums
The Correct Answer is C
A. Upset stomach: An upset stomach is not typically associated with anaphylaxis. It could be a symptom of many other less severe conditions.
B. Hallucinations: Hallucinations are not a common symptom of anaphylaxis. They might occur in other medical conditions or as a side effect of certain drugs.
C. Wheezing: Wheezing is a classic sign of anaphylaxis, indicating airway constriction due to a severe allergic reaction.
D. Bleeding gums: Bleeding gums are not a sign of anaphylaxis. They may indicate a different medical issue, such as a blood clotting disorder.
